Snow covers the grounds of Chinook H inds Casino Resort on Jan. // Most areas of the northern and central Oregon coast received at least 3 inches of snow. with several areas getting 6 inches or more. Althu. \h most streets cleared within a day. cold temperatures kept the snow around for about a week. After the show. Bob Eubanks will sign autographs. Harry Rinker, also known as HGTV's Collector Inspector, is return ing for Lincoln City's Antique Week. Along with other local appear ances. Rinker will lecture and hold verbal appraisal clinics Feb. 17-18 in the Chinook Winds Convention Center. Those with an eye for antiques will enjoy listening to Rinker s expertise. Hours for the Appraiseathon are I p.m. to 5 p.m. on Feb. 17 and noon to 4 p.m. on Feb. 18. Lincoln City's Antique Week's highlight is the Appraiseathon with re nowned antique specialist Harry Rinker. Having items appraised can help with estate planning or deciding whether to keep or sell an heirloom. For a fee. Rinker will professionally appraise up to three items. The cost to have one item appraised is $10 and for $25, you can have three items appraised. Space fills up fast. Chance to win an extra $50-$400 on each Main Session game! fl 1 §5 & Don’t Miss the Siletz Tribal and Employee Craft Fair Siletz Tribal artisans and Chinook Winds Casino Resort employees will sell their creations at the Chinook Winds Arts & Crafts Fair on Feb. 17-18 in the Chinook Winds Convention Center. This event is open to all ages and there is no charge for admission. This is your chance to purchase hand crafted items direct from the skilled individuals who create them. There also will be a tribal history display as part of Antique Week. The event will be held in conjunction with the Harry Rinker Appraisathon also taking place in the casino's convention center. A diverse selection of items will be available for purchase throughout the two-day event. All participating artists are either a Chinook Winds employee or member of the Confederated Tribes of Siletz Indians. Hours for the Arts & Crafts Fair arc 10 a.m. to 4 p.m. both days.
